Idrees Ahmed: Championing inclusion through identity and intersectionality

We recently caught up with Idrees Ahmed, a graduate of our HR scheme and Deputy Co-Chair of L&G’s ‘Socio-Economic Mobility’ internal network, to talk about how identity, visibility, and support systems have shaped his journey, both personally and professionally.

Idrees grew up in one of Birmingham’s most deprived areas, in a household where English wasn’t spoken at home. As a first-generation university student, he studied Global Health and Pharmacology at King’s College London, a journey shaped by opportunity, mentorship, and a drive to make a difference. 

Now at L&G, he’s using his voice to advocate for inclusion, particularly around the intersection of sexuality and socio-economic background. As a gay man raised in a South Asian household, Idrees shares how navigating identity has been both powerful and challenging, and how this Pride Month, he’s choosing to celebrate intersectionality more than ever.

“It’s difficult to separate identity from the workplace. But if there isn’t someone creating that space, you are the incredible person creating it without even realising.”

Why visibility and allyship matter

For Idrees, Pride Month 2025 is a time to be seen, and to help others feel seen too. It’s a chance to celebrate the people who offer support behind the scenes, the colleagues who listen, and the mentors who open doors. 

“With so many characteristics that make me diverse, I’ve often struggled to feel like I belong in the rooms I’m in,” he shares. 

He credits L&G’s inclusive culture and internal networks for giving him space to grow. From hosting Insight Days for young people to volunteering in schools, his work is powered by a clear purpose: helping others see what’s possible.

“Your story matters, no matter how many times it’s been told. To our allies: thank you. But please, keep listening, stay curious, and check in on those around you.” 

“I recently joined a team where I see that visibility in some of my senior colleagues, people whose struggles I can only imagine, but their presence alone reminds me that you can thrive in what you do, and life goes on.”
